The Black-eared Shrike-babbler (Pteruthius melanotis) is a bird species documented in the AviList Global Avian Checklist. It belongs to the family Vireonidae (Shrike-babblers, Erpornis, and Vireos) in the order Passeriformes.

The AviList checklist recognises 2 subspecies for this species.
- Pteruthius melanotis melanotis
- Pteruthius melanotis tahanensis
Taxonomic history
- First described as
- Pt[eruthius] melanotis
- Described by
- Hodgson, BH, 1847
- Type locality
- the Terai, at base of southeastern Himalayas ; type from Nepal, fide Gadow, 1883, Cat. Birds Brit. Mus., 8, p. 118.
- Original description
- Journal of the Asiatic Society of Bengal 16, pt.1 p.448
